What are you looking for?

Explore our services and discover how we can help you achieve your goals

Frontend vs Backend: Understanding the Core of Web Development

  1. Home

  2. Website Development & Management

  3. Frontend vs Backend: Understanding the Core of Web Development

Background image
Frontend vs Backend: Understanding the Core of Web Development

Frontend and backend development are the two fundamental components of modern web applications. This blog explains their roles, differences, technologies, and how they work together to create seamless digital experiences.

Aastha Sharma
Aastha Sharma

Feb 23, 2026

3 mins to read
Frontend vs Backend: Understanding the Core of Web Development

Frontend vs Backend: Understanding the Core of Web Development

Web development is the foundation of every digital experience we interact with today, from business websites to complex web applications. At its core, web development is divided into two main components - frontend and backend. Understanding how these two areas work together is essential for building fast, secure, and scalable digital platforms.

This guide explores the differences between frontend and backend development, their roles, technologies, and why both are critical for modern web development.


What Is Frontend Development?

Frontend development refers to the part of a website or application that users interact with directly. It focuses on the visual design, layout, and user experience.

Frontend developers ensure that websites are responsive, visually appealing, and easy to navigate across different devices and screen sizes.

Key Responsibilities

• Designing user interfaces
• Creating responsive layouts
• Improving user experience
• Implementing interactive elements
• Ensuring cross-browser compatibility


Common Frontend Technologies

• HTML for structure
• CSS for styling
• JavaScript for interactivity
• Frameworks like React, Angular, and Vue


What Is Backend Development?

Backend development focuses on the server-side of applications. It manages databases, server logic, authentication, and application functionality that users do not see.

Backend developers ensure that data is processed correctly, systems are secure, and applications run smoothly.

Key Responsibilities

• Managing databases
• Building server logic
• Handling user authentication
• Ensuring application security
• Managing APIs


Common Backend Technologies

• Programming languages like Python, Java, PHP, Node.js
• Databases such as MySQL, PostgreSQL, MongoDB
• Server frameworks and APIs


Key Differences Between Frontend and Backend

  1. User Interaction

Frontend handles what users see and interact with, while backend manages data processing behind the scenes.

  2. Focus Area

Frontend focuses on design and user experience, whereas backend focuses on functionality and logic.

  3. Technologies

Frontend uses UI technologies, while backend relies on server-side languages and databases.

  4. Performance Role

Frontend impacts user experience and speed, while backend ensures data accuracy and application performance.


How Frontend and Backend Work Together

Both frontend and backend communicate through APIs to deliver seamless functionality. When a user performs an action on a website, the frontend sends a request to the backend, which processes the request and returns the necessary data.

This collaboration ensures smooth user experiences and reliable system performance.


Importance of Full-Stack Development

Full-stack development combines both frontend and backend skills, allowing developers to build complete applications. Businesses benefit from full-stack capabilities as it improves efficiency and simplifies project management.


Why Businesses Need Both?

A successful digital platform requires a strong frontend to engage users and a reliable backend to ensure functionality and security. Ignoring either component can lead to poor performance, security risks, and bad user experiences.


Challenges in Frontend and Backend Development

  1. Maintaining performance across devices
  2.  Ensuring data security
  3. Managing scalability
  4. Integrating multiple systems
  5. Keeping technologies updated

Best Practices for Modern Web Development

• Focus on responsive design
• Optimize website performance
• Implement strong security measures
• Use scalable backend architecture
• Maintain clean and efficient code


Insights

Frontend and backend development together form the backbone of modern web applications. While frontend creates engaging user experiences, backend ensures functionality, security, and performance. Businesses that understand and invest in both components can build reliable, scalable, and high-performing digital platforms.

As web technologies continue to evolve, the synergy between frontend and backend will remain essential for delivering seamless digital experiences.

Share this post:

Related Posts
Website Security Best Practices Every Business Should Follow
Website Development & ManagementWebsite Security Best Practices Every Business Should Follow

Website security is essential for protecting data, maintaining customer trust, and ensuring business...

How to Manage Multiple Websites Efficiently from a Single Dashboard
Website Development & ManagementHow to Manage Multiple Websites Efficiently from a Single Dashboard

Managing multiple websites can be complex without the right tools and strategy. This blog explores h...

How Smart Plugin Integration Can Transform Your Digital Operations
Website Development & ManagementHow Smart Plugin Integration Can Transform Your Digital Operations

Smart plugin integration helps businesses improve website performance, strengthen security, automate...

dotsWeekly Digital Insights

Join our community.

Get one email every Tuesday with the latest tech updates and marketing tips. No spam, just high-value content to help you scale your business.

icon
icon
Your experience on this site will be improved by allowing cookies.